Sourcing Forgings for the South's Historic Steel City and Its Growing Automotive Corridor

Birmingham earned its historic reputation as one of the American South's principal centers of iron and steel production, a legacy tied to the region's unusual natural concentration of the raw materials — iron ore, coal, and limestone — needed for steelmaking, all found within a short distance of one another. This heavy industry heritage, sometimes described by the nickname "the Pittsburgh of the South," left Birmingham with a deep base of metalworking, foundry, and heavy engineering expertise that continues to shape the regional economy today. In the decades since, the broader Alabama region has additionally developed into a genuine and growing center of automotive manufacturing, with vehicle assembly operations and an expanding automotive component supply chain established across the state, adding a substantial new layer of manufacturing activity alongside Birmingham's traditional steel and heavy industry base. Together, these two industrial identities — legacy steel and heavy engineering manufacturing, and a growing automotive component supply chain — create a genuinely broad base of demand for forged carbon and alloy steel components, spanning heavy industrial equipment applications on one hand and steering, suspension, and driveline components on the other.

Standards, Logistics & Documentation for Birmingham Shipments

SAE/AISI Material Grade Compliance

Forgings supplied in SAE/AISI-designated carbon and alloy steel grades common to Southeastern US steel and automotive component manufacturing, with chemistry and mechanical property certification matched to your specification.

IATF 16949-Aligned Documentation for Automotive Buyers

PPAP-format submission packages and dimensional inspection reports prepared to align with IATF 16949 quality system expectations common among Alabama's automotive component buyers.

Ocean Freight to Gulf & Southeast Ports

Shipments from Mundra or Nhava Sheva to US Gulf Coast or Southeast ports, with onward rail or road transport to Birmingham, typically transit in the range of four to five weeks depending on routing.

CIF, FOB & EXW Incoterms

Shipping terms arranged per customer preference with full export documentation, mill test certificates, and dimensional inspection reports prepared for US customs clearance and incoming quality inspection.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do you supply forgings for steel and heavy industry equipment manufacturers in Birmingham?

Yes. We supply forged carbon and alloy steel shaft, gear, and structural component blanks engineered for demanding heavy industrial equipment applications, matched to Birmingham's legacy steel and heavy industry base.

Can you supply forgings for automotive component manufacturers in Alabama?

Yes. We supply forged blanks for steering, suspension, and driveline components in medium-carbon and alloy steel grades, with PPAP-format documentation aligned to IATF 16949 quality expectations common among automotive buyers.

What is the typical lead time for shipments to Birmingham?

Production lead time depends on component complexity, typically 3 to 8 weeks. Ocean freight from Indian ports to US Gulf Coast or Southeast ports, plus onward inland transport, generally adds four to five weeks.

What material grades do you supply for heavy engineering and fabrication applications?

Common grades include SAE/AISI 1045, 4140, and similar carbon and alloy steel grades for structural and shaft component applications, supplied with full chemistry and mechanical property certification.

Do you provide material test certificates for incoming inspection?

Yes. Every shipment includes mill test certificates and dimensional inspection reports as standard, with EN 10204 3.1/3.2 format documentation available on request.
